Question 907208: 5x-y+z=4, 3x=2y-3z=36, x-3y+2z=-25 Complete the ordered triple

Assuming that is +2y in the second equation
(3,6,-5)
5,-1,1,4
3,2,-3,36
1,-3,2,-25
divide row 1 by 5
1,-1/5,1/5,4/5
3,2,-3,36
1,-3,2,-25
add down (-3) *row 1 to row 2
1,-1/5,1/5,4/5
0,13/5,-18/5,168/5
1,-3,2,-25
add down (-1) *row 1 to row 3
1,-1/5,1/5,4/5
0,13/5,-18/5,168/5
0,-14/5,9/5,-129/5
divide row 2 by 13/5
1,-1/5,1/5,4/5
0,1,-90/65,840/65
0,-14/5,9/5,-129/5
add down (14/5) *row 2 to row 3
1,-1/5,1/5,4/5
0,1,-18/13,168/13
0,0,-675/325,3375/325
divide row 3 by -27/13
1,-1/5,1/5,4/5
0,1,-18/13,168/13
0,0,1,-5
We now have the value for the last variable.
We will work our way up and get the other solutions.
add up (18/13) *row 3 to row 2
1,-1/5,1/5,4/5
0,1,0,6
0,0,1,-5
add up (-1/5) *row 3 to row 1
1,-5/25,0,45/25
0,1,0,6
0,0,1,-5
add up (5/25) *row 2 to row 1
1,0,0,3
0,1,0,6
0,0,1,-5
final
1,0,0,3
0,1,0,6
0,0,1,-5
1,0,0,3
0,1,0,6
0,0,1,-5
"3","6","-5"
(3,6,-5)
